I was fortunate to work on National Geographic's new documentary series called 'WWII Skies from above' which manifested into a 6 month project. I worked on 90+ animated scenes which mainly used projection mapping techniques in C4D to create depth and cinematic appeal to old WWII archive images.

I'm in the process of creating a case study reel to show some of my favourite scenes and show some behind the scenes workings. I want to package the case study in it's own distinct style so I designed some frames which took inspiration from old WWII war room maps. I will use this 3D environment to move around and transition in and out of scenes related to the documentary project.
